What is a logistics account manager?

A Logistics Account Manager is a professional responsible for overseeing, coordinating, and optimizing the transportation and delivery of goods for clients. They act as the main point of contact between clients and logistics service providers, ensuring that shipments are managed efficiently and cost-effectively. Their duties often include managing customer accounts, negotiating rates, tracking shipments, and resolving issues that arise during the shipping process. Logistics Account Managers play a crucial role in maintaining client satisfaction and building long-term business relationships.

How does a logistics account manager typically collaborate with other departments to ensure client satisfaction?

A Logistics Account Manager works closely with operations, customer service, and sales teams to deliver seamless solutions for clients. They coordinate with operations to ensure timely shipments, partner with customer service to resolve any issues quickly, and frequently communicate with sales to align on client needs and contract terms. Effective collaboration across these departments helps maintain strong client relationships and ensures that service expectations are consistently met.

What does a logistics account manager do?

A logistics account manager helps provide logistics services to clients. In this job, your duties include working to develop a relationship with clients and liaising between the client and the shipping logistics company. You need to understand the kinds of goods or commodities a company ships and also have experience with the geographical locations they operate and ship their products to. Qualifications for this career include a bachelor’s degree in marketing, management, or logistics, along with strong interpersonal, communication, and organizational skills.

The Logistics Account Manager focuses on managing client accounts, coordinating shipments, and optimizing supply chain processes, often requiring logistics certifications. In contrast, Customer Service Representatives handle client inquiries, resolve issues, and provide support primarily related to products or services. While both roles involve communication and client interaction, the Logistics Account Manager is specialized in supply chain management within logistics firms, whereas Customer Service Representatives work across various industries emphasizing customer support.

Is a logistics account manager a stressful job?

A logistics account manager role can be stressful due to managing multiple client accounts, coordinating shipments, and meeting tight deadlines. The job often requires strong organizational skills, problem-solving, and the ability to handle high-pressure situations, especially during peak periods or when resolving issues with shipments or deliveries.

In 1976, ten independent hauliers joined forces and founded DSV in Denmark. Since then, DSV has evolved to become the world's 3rd largest supplier of global solutions within transport and logistics. Today, we add value to our customers' entire supply chain by transporting, storing, packaging, re-packaging, processing and clearing all types of goods. We work every day from our many offices in more than 80 countries to ensure a steady supply of goods to production lines, outlets, stores and consumers all over the world.
